Transaction dc7c75cec5a19e1a664ec11838179cbb4917e25f022d0e3c0e971e90c1d50444
1 Input
1 Output
-
dc7c75cec5a19e1a664ec11838179cbb4917e25f022d0e3c0e971e90c1d50444:0
- value
- 3868669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cfb146eb4dfcf80227663ce6beac65234ec4f76 OP_EQUAL
- address
- 38i44TJAuncdLVPUkfTeGsm5PeV6QAWnFx